Tips for Printing and Using the Coloring Pages
It’s a personal preference on how thick of paper to use. The thicker the paper, the less likely to have bleeding. But make sure not to use glossy paper because the colors will smear.
If you want the best results, print on a slightly thicker paper like this bristol paper so markers do not bleed through and colors stay rich and smooth. Delivery time for printing is instant, so you can start coloring the moment you download your files.
My top tips and ideas for adult coloring pages are to start with lighter colors and build up darker tones so the line art stays clear. Choose color schemes before you start to help guide your design. Work from larger areas to smaller details so the intricate patterns stay clean.

Most importantly, pick the pages that best fit your mood. Some days you may want a beach scene with bright colors, and other days a cozy reading nook might feel more relaxing.
